Usage Note
Sous-estimer is formed from sous- ('under') + estimer ('to estimate/value'). Its opposite is surestimer ('to overestimate'). The reflexive se sous-estimer means to sell yourself short — a common theme in self-help contexts. Both forms are widely used in professional and personal development discussions in French.
Examples
"Ne sous-estimez jamais vos adversaires."
Natural Translation
Never underestimate your opponents.
